ABSOLUTE FLASH #6: The Rogues

Published:

Absolute Flash #6 takes us on a brief break from the heart-pounding pace we have been at to give us some backstory on the infamous Rogues. Colonel West takes us on a road trip across America, selecting his gallery of veterans and delving into a past mission fraught with failure.

*SPOILERS AHEAD*

Jeff is giving immense Suicide Squad vibes in this unique backstory-filled issue. He has found a way to make Flash’s Rogue Gallery injected with a fresh and intriguing origin as perhaps the most shocking thing to me is how Barry Allen is a scientist who creates them. The middle of this issue alludes to something happening in the past with another famous character which has me wondering how many threads that are being laid out will come into play.

Even more shocking is how Allen is working with Elenor Thawne. The name and gender may have changed, but no matter what, the name will live up to what we have all come to expect. This story has continued to find a way to grip me and become captivating bringing me to the edge of my seat.

Robles and Lucas do an incredible job with the character details in this issue. Barry Allen, as we meet him, is nothing but smiles and his traditional blonde hair; however, there is an icy feeling to his smile and the way they have detailed him that is just enough to make us feel something is off. The duo does the same with Thawne, as half her face is hidden, and yet they add the icy feeling to her, bringing depth to more than just what we know about Thawne.

The art team invokes a feeling of empathy towards the Rogues as well and Jeff and team give us time with them before the lab. Once we enter the lab, Nick and Adriano plant a lot of details and shadow figures in the background that fill us with a sense of wonder.

Absolute Flash #6 takes us into the backstory for the Rogues as we see how they came to be and fills us with a sense of intrigue and dread at just what is happening with the government blacksite. It injects new life into this thrilling run, immediately bringing me to the edge of my seat with the shocking ending.
